Ppl always sending physical cues to show that they acknowledge another person"s humanness. Socialization: how children are raised and become members of society. Human beings evolved as biological creatures to require vast amounts of social/cultural software in order to function. Humans learn almost everything from their environment; no such thing as a human being w/o culture. Literate brains organized differently from illiterate brains. Nature/nurture model isn"t complete; you need both to function. Biological sex: biological anatomy: male, female, intersex. Gender: category you are assigned; recognized social identity connected to biology. Sex roles: ways you are expected to behave based on gender.
